Abstract: William Henry Sedley Smith (1806-1872) was an actor and stage manager who first
appeared in the United States at the Walnut Street Theatre in Philadelphia in 1827. During his later years he
was both actor and stage manager at the California Theatre in San Francisco. The collection contains five
holograph sides, circa 1869-1872, presumably for roles Smith performed at the California Theatre in San
Francisco. Sides are defined as pages containing an actor's part and cue words.

Biography
William Henry Sedley Smith was born in Wales in 1806. After touring the English provinces for several years, in
1827 he came to the United States where he made his first appearance at the Walnut Street Theatre in
Philadelphia as Jeremy Diddler in
Raising the Wind.
He was stage manager of the Boston Museum from 1843 to 1860. In 1869 he traveled to San Francisco where he was
stage manager of the California Theatre until his death on January 17, 1872.

Scope and Content
The collection contains five holograph sides, circa 1869-1872, presumably for roles Smith performed at the
California Theatre in San Francisco. Sides are defined as pages containing an actor's part and cue words.
